Transaction 39df102ee79697d549cfc98826d55c5ff6973b522e772fa2589233f292d626bd
1 Input
2 Outputs
- 39df102ee79697d549cfc98826d55c5ff6973b522e772fa2589233f292d626bd:0
- 39df102ee79697d549cfc98826d55c5ff6973b522e772fa2589233f292d626bd:1
value 146932
address 1BDej5MCAhiAZU3Ho7mYDMpqRpxoSEb7vW
value 983099475
address 1CMeUutknbWKCwNGxbaykHkLFxxdVk4QkR